Readability and Mobile Responsiveness

One of my biggest concerns when testing new fonts is how they render on smaller screens. A font that looks great on a 27-inch monitor can become illegible on a smartphone. I resized the browser window to simulate various mobile viewports. Because Éco Sans Pro Extended has a generous x-height and open counters, it remained surprisingly readable even at smaller sizes, though I reserved it primarily for headlines rather than body copy.

For body text, I paired it with a neutral, highly legible sans serif font. This is a classic font pairing strategy. The decorative, handwritten quality of Éco Sans Pro Extended provides the personality and brand voice, while the simple sans serif handles the heavy lifting of long-form content. This combination ensures that the site feels premium and curated without causing eye strain for the reader. It creates a professional digital experience that respects the user’s time and attention.

Technical Considerations for Web Implementation

Before finalizing any font choice for a client project, I always check the technical specs. Performance matters. A beautiful font that slows down page load times is a liability. When working with Éco Sans Pro Extended, I ensured that the webfont files were optimized. Using modern formats like WOFF2 helps keep the file size small, ensuring that the text renders quickly even on slower connections.

Licensing is another critical factor. Whether you are building a SaaS platform, an online store, or a simple blog, you must ensure you have the correct commercial font license. I verified that the license covered web usage, which allowed me to embed the font directly into the CSS. This ensures consistent rendering across different browsers and devices, maintaining the integrity of the design assets.

I also explored the included styles and alternates. Having access to different weights or stylistic sets can provide flexibility in editorial design and packaging design applications beyond just the web. For this project, the standard bold weight was sufficient, but knowing there were options gave me peace of mind for future iterations of the brand kit.
